  • Publication number: 20030084409
    Abstract: A method and apparatus for extracting circuit design information from a pre-existing semiconductor integrated circuit (IC) or at least a portion thereof is described. It includes imaging at least a portion of two or more physical layers of the pre-existing IC to obtain stored electronic images of the physical IC layers, converting the stored electronic images of the physical IC layers to a vector format, horizontally and vertically aligning the vector format data of the electronic images of the physical IC layers, and providing a multi-layer display of the aligned vector data. A net-list or schematic is generated from the multi-layer display of the vector data. The netlist and/or schematic may be generated as a number of individual pages by providing a template of circuit elements and placing a circuit element over a portion of the display corresponding to the circuit element. The template of circuit elements may include transistors, logic gates or complex circuit blocks.
